### VB语言教材管理系统的开发与应用
#### 一、引言
随着信息技术的快速发展,教育领域也迎来了数字化转型的关键时期。传统的纸质教材管理方式已经难以满足现代教学的需求,因此,开发一套高效、实用的教材管理系统成为了迫切需要解决的问题。本文档主要介绍了基于VB语言的教材管理系统的设计与实现过程,包括系统需求分析、设计思路、具体实现方法以及最终的应用效果等。
#### 二、项目背景及意义
在当前信息化教育背景下,如何有效地管理和利用教材资源对于提高教学质量和效率具有重要意义。传统的教材管理方式存在诸多问题,如信息更新不及时、资源浪费严重等。因此,开发一个能够有效整合和管理教材资源的系统,不仅能够提升教学资源的利用率,还能帮助教师和学生更加便捷地获取所需教材资料,从而促进教学质量的提升。
#### 三、系统设计与实现
##### 3.1 需求分析
在系统开发之前,首先需要对用户的需求进行详细的调研和分析。根据调研结果,系统的主要功能需求包括但不限于:
- **教材录入与管理**:支持教材的基本信息录入(如教材名称、作者、出版社等),并能方便地对教材信息进行查询、修改或删除。
- **库存管理**:记录每本教材的库存数量,支持入库和出库操作,并能自动更新库存状态。
- **借阅管理**:提供教材的借阅服务,记录借阅人的基本信息以及借阅时间、归还时间等信息。
- **权限管理**:区分不同的用户角色(如管理员、普通用户等),为不同角色分配相应的操作权限。
##### 3.2 技术选型
本系统采用VB语言作为开发工具,主要因为VB语言具有以下优势:
- **易学易用**:对于初学者来说,VB语言的学习曲线较为平缓,容易上手。
- **界面友好**:VB提供了丰富的控件库,可以快速搭建美观的用户界面。
- **数据库集成**:VB内置了强大的数据库处理能力,方便与各种数据库进行交互。
##### 3.3 系统架构设计
系统采用了典型的三层架构设计模式,分别为表示层、业务逻辑层和数据访问层:
- **表示层**:负责用户界面的展示和用户输入的接收。
- **业务逻辑层**:实现系统的业务逻辑处理,如教材信息的增删改查等。
- **数据访问层**:负责与数据库的交互,实现数据的存储和读取。
##### 3.4 关键技术实现
- **用户界面设计**:利用VB提供的Form控件来设计用户界面,通过Button、TextBox等控件实现功能操作。
- **数据库连接**:采用ADO技术(ActiveX Data Objects)实现与SQL Server数据库的连接,完成数据的增删改查操作。
- **权限控制**:通过设置不同的用户账号和密码,结合角色管理功能实现对不同用户的权限控制。
#### 四、系统测试与评估
为了确保系统的稳定性和可靠性,在系统开发完成后进行了全面的测试工作,主要包括单元测试、集成测试和系统测试三个阶段。测试过程中,针对每个模块的功能进行了详尽的验证,确保系统能够正常运行且满足用户的需求。
#### 五、总结与展望
通过本项目的实施,不仅成功开发了一套基于VB语言的教材管理系统,而且也为未来的教育信息化建设积累了宝贵的经验和技术基础。未来,该系统还可以进一步拓展功能,如增加在线阅读、电子书下载等功能,更好地服务于广大师生。
本项目旨在通过信息技术手段提高教材资源的管理水平,进而推动教育信息化的发展。